-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at before cooking the sausages to ensure even cooking.
- Soak wooden skewers in water for at least 30 minutes if you're using them to skewer the figs or sausages, to prevent them from burning.
- When selecting figs, choose ones that are plump and slightly soft to the touch for the best sweetness and flavor.
- Crumble the goat cheese evenly over the greens rather than in large chunks to ensure every bite has a bit of creamy texture.
- Mix the mint leaves well with the greens to evenly distribute the flavor throughout the salad.
- Lightly brush the sausages with Italian salad dressing before grilling to enhance their flavor profile.
- Allow the grilled sausages to rest for a few minutes before slicing to maintain their juiciness.
